Cleaving meaning
Cleaving is a word that has multiple meanings and can be used in various contexts. It can refer to the act of splitting or cutting something in two, or it can also mean to adhere or stick to something. In this article, we will provide tips on how to use the word cleaving in a sentence.
1. Use cleaving to describe the act of splitting or cutting something in two. Example: The lumberjack was cleaving the logs with his axe. In this sentence, cleaving is used to describe the action of the lumberjack splitting the logs into two pieces. When using cleaving in this context, it is important to make sure that the sentence is clear and concise, and that the action being described is easily understood.
2. Use cleaving to describe the act of adhering or sticking to something. Example: The magnet was cleaving to the metal surface. In this sentence, cleaving is used to describe the action of the magnet sticking to the metal surface.
